As of October 2025, the average salary for an Instructional Systems Designer is estimated at $65,907 annually. This figure reflects a range of salaries influenced by factors such as education level, years of experience, and geographic location.
Entry-level designers can expect to earn significantly less, while those with advanced degrees or extensive experience may see salaries exceeding $90,000. The demand for skilled instructional designers is growing, particularly in sectors like education and corporate environments.
Salaries vary widely across states. Places like California and New York often offer higher salaries, reflecting the cost of living and demand for skilled professionals in these areas. Additionally, urban centers tend to pay more due to competitive job markets.
Instructional Systems Designers can find roles in various industries including healthcare, technology, and government. Positions may involve creating e-learning modules, developing training materials, or designing instructional strategies that enhance learning experiences.

| Experience level | Avg. salary | Hourly rate |
|---|---|---|
| Entry-level instructional systems designer | $57,100 | $27.46 |
| Mid-level instructional systems designer | $72,400 | $34.80 |
| Senior-level instructional systems designer | $83,900 | $40.33 |

An instructional systems designer's salary ranges from $46,000 a year at the 10th percentile to $93,000 at the 90th percentile.

| Percentile | Annual salary | Monthly salary | Hourly rate |
|---|---|---|---|
| 90th Percentile | $93,000 | $7,750 | $45 |
| 75th Percentile | $79,000 | $6,583 | $38 |
| Average | $65,907 | $5,492 | $32 |
| 25th Percentile | $54,000 | $4,500 | $26 |
| 10th Percentile | $46,000 | $3,833 | $22 |

The average instructional systems designer salary has risen by $7,568 over the last ten years. In 2014, the average instructional systems designer earned $58,339 annually, but today, they earn $65,907 a year. That works out to a 7% change in pay for instructional systems designers over the last decade.
